An EMP would be devastating.  There are so many people reliant upon medical devices that need energy.  I doubt they have the back-up energy to run them.  Medical services will greatly suffer.

I have always felt an EMP is the first logical step in the next war.  A simple pulse, knocks out all of our electrical grid and equipment. We are stranded with no electricity for gas pumps, no means to manage inventory, cash flow, and NO back-up systems for the financial complex.

EMP is one reason we went to a gas range.  Well, propane; which is also our heat source.

I agree with Tolik. People would need to adapt to survive.  We would go back 100 years.  Hand washing your socks!  Are you ready?
